Abstract

Results on computer simulations of a lumped single-pump FOPA (fiber optical parametric amplifier) are presented. We demonstrate optical amplification of a 10 Gbit/s 4-channel S-band DWDM system utilizing a lumped FOPA on a 400 km long link with 80 km long inter-amplifier spans. In most of the recent papers in the field of fiber optical parametric amplifiers research the amount of amplification and the gain bandwidth are considered as the FOPA parameters. We evaluate the effectiveness of FOPA through BER parameter, which depends on both the attenuation of optical signal and the quality degradation due to dispersion, crosstalk and amplifier noise, and therefore is more suitable for evaluation of optical amplifiers in lightwave systems.
